## Changelog — Ticktrace 1.9

### Renamed: DRIFT_API_TOKEN
During the cron drift investigation we found plugins confusing this variable with the metrics token, so it has been renamed to indicate it authorizes drift-report uploads specifically. Plugin authors must read the new name from 1.9 onward; the old name is ignored without warning. Sample env files in the SDK are updated. In your deployment env file, the drift-report upload secret is set on the next line.

env line for fawef-taguf: VAULT_KEY13=a9695905a9a90

Handover: the Driftwood sweeper now runs hourly and deletes orphaned volumes in the Karnel cluster after a 48-hour grace window. Watch for false positives on snapshots tagged by Lomira's batch jobs; I added an exclusion list but it's not exhaustive. If the sweep count spikes above 200, pause the job first. Full runbook and pause instructions live here.

dashboard of kafop-yagep = https://jira.zemvarsys.internal/pages/pages/pages/display/cc87

Subject: Gridmonger cut-over — done!

Hi Tolja, welcome aboard. Quick recap: we moved the crossword generator off the old batch host last night. Puzzle seeds now come from the new dictionary service, and clue ranking is fully async. Nothing exploded, one retry storm, already tamed. You'll want the live settings to get your sandbox matching production, so here they are.

deployment values, kajep-kageg:
[praix]
host = praix.paliqcorp.corp
user = praix_svc
database = praix_prod

## Sorting Stability in Chartloom

Quick heads-up for new folks: the Chartloom report builder uses a stable sort everywhere, and customers rely on that. If two rows tie on the sort column, they keep their original order — lots of finance reports from the Penwick accounts depend on this. So never swap in a faster unstable sort without flagging it in review. There's a regression test suite under `sort_stability/`; run it before merging anything touching ordering. Questions about edge cases go to the reporting team.

escalation mailbox, bafog-fafog: ulador@paliqlabs.internal